Tips for Parents Driving Long Distances With a Baby
Plan Your Route Carefully
Always plan your stops before you start. Choose baby-friendly rest areas with clean facilities. Make sure to take a break every two to three hours to feed, change, or comfort your baby.

Keep Your Baby Comfortable
Dress your baby in light and soft clothes. Carry extra diapers, wipes, and a blanket. Maintain a comfortable car temperature and keep your baby’s favourite toy nearby to avoid fussiness.
Pack Smart and Stay Organised
Keep essentials like baby food, formula, and water within reach. Pack a small bag with baby items for easy access. This saves time and helps you stay calm when your baby needs quick attention.

Is it safe to travel long distances with a newborn?
Yes, with proper breaks, comfort, and planning, it can be safe.
How often should I stop during a long drive?
Every two to three hours for feeding, diaper changes, and stretching.
How can I calm my baby during travel?
Play soft music or talk gently to comfort your baby.
